Output a91a63a903f2f69eed60bd0efef0d114459193614ca89fff4e939fbd910f271d: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4c58d95c39b16c7fca82a44af5071b6e935e42 OP_EQUAL
address
3DCpXQF9oetYLvhyDwsR3TZrzhmqhgP9QG
transaction
a91a63a903f2f69eed60bd0efef0d114459193614ca89fff4e939fbd910f271d
spent
true